温馨提示×

php imagecopyresized 能处理大图吗

PHP
小樊
85
2024-12-06 02:06:51
栏目: 编程语言
PHP开发者专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

是的,PHP的imagecopyresized函数可以处理大图片

imagecopyresized函数的基本语法如下:

bool imagecopyresized ( resource $dst_image, resource $src_image, int $dst_x, int $dst_y, int $src_x, int $src_y, int $dst_width, int $dst_height, int $src_width, int $src_height )

参数说明:

  • $dst_image:目标图像资源。
  • $src_image:源图像资源。
  • $dst_x:目标图像中复制内容的起始横坐标。
  • $dst_y:目标图像中复制内容的起始纵坐标。
  • $src_x:源图像中复制内容的起始横坐标。
  • $src_y:源图像中复制内容的起始纵坐标。
  • $dst_width:目标图像中复制内容的宽度。
  • $dst_height:目标图像中复制内容的高度。
  • $src_width:源图像中复制内容的宽度。
  • $src_height:源图像中复制内容的高度。

要处理大图片,你需要确保服务器有足够的内存和处理能力。你可以尝试优化代码,例如通过调整图像尺寸以减少处理时间。此外,你还可以考虑使用其他图像处理库,如ImageMagick,它可能提供更好的性能和更多的功能。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读:php imagecopyresized 能否缩放矢量图

0